Vertical detail of a relief of Cleopatra and Caesarion, Temple of Hathor, Dendera, c125 BC-c60 AD
Vertical detail of a Relief of Cleopatra VII and Caesarion (her son by Julius Caesar) offering to the gods, Temple of Hathor, Dendera, Egypt, late Ptolemaic and Roman, c125 BC- 60 AD. Temple of Hathor was dedicated to Hathor and Horus the Elder

EDITORS COMMENTS
This print showcases a vertical detail of a relief found in the Temple of Hathor, Dendera. Dating back to the late Ptolemaic and Roman periods (c125 BC-c60 AD), this remarkable artwork depicts Cleopatra VII, the iconic queen of Egypt, alongside her son Caesarion. The relief captures a poignant moment as they offer their devotion to the gods. Carved meticulously into stone, every intricate detail is brought to life with vibrant colors that have stood the test of time. This masterpiece not only represents religious worship but also symbolizes family ties and royal lineage. The Temple of Hathor itself was dedicated to both Hathor and Horus the Elder, making it an important center for spiritual practices during ancient times.
